Why 95% of AI Projects Fail

MIT’s 2025 study, The GenAI Divide, found that 95% of corporate AI pilots delivered no measurable return. Here’s what’s interesting: It isn’t a technology problem. It’s a process and implementation problem.

“We worked with Selda and the Quantum Lane AI team for close to a year on an AI discovery and consulting engagement focused on automating email response handling across our events portfolio. The scope of what they delivered was impressive – from a fully validated business case, and a working AI prototype tested against real Gastech enquiries, to a comprehensive technical architecture, and a detailed security and compliance assessment.

What stood out most was Selda’s ability to get under the skin of our business. She took the time to understand how our operations teams actually work, identified where AI could genuinely make a difference, and translated that into a clear, well-structured plan that our technology and leadership teams could engage with. The financial modelling alone identified a potential £2–2.5 million saving over three years across our 115 events — which gave us a solid foundation for internal decision-making.

Beyond the IERAI project itself, Selda also identified several other high-value AI opportunities for us including lead reactivation across our database of over a million historical contacts, and self-serve capabilities for exhibitors and delegates. She consistently went above and beyond.
